实现命令行执行mysql语句的流程

流程图如下:

flowchart TD
    A[准备mysql命令行环境] --> B[连接到mysql数据库]
    B --> C[执行mysql语句]
    C --> D[关闭mysql连接]

1. 准备mysql命令行环境

在开始执行mysql语句之前,我们需要先准备好mysql命令行环境。这包括安装和配置mysql客户端,以及确保mysql服务正常运行。

2. 连接到mysql数据库

在执行mysql语句之前,我们需要先连接到要操作的mysql数据库。这可以通过使用mysql客户端提供的连接命令来实现。以下是连接到mysql数据库的代码示例:

mysql -h localhost -P 3306 -u username -p
  • -h 参数指定需要连接的mysql主机,此处为localhost,表示连接到本地数据库;
  • -P 参数指定mysql服务的端口号,此处为3306,默认的mysql端口号;
  • -u 参数指定连接mysql所使用的用户名,此处为username,请将其替换为实际的用户名;
  • -p 参数表示需要输入密码来进行身份验证。

连接成功后,将会提示输入密码。

3. 执行mysql语句

连接成功后,就可以开始执行mysql语句了。mysql语句可以包括数据库操作、数据查询、表创建、数据插入等等。

以下是执行mysql语句的代码示例:

mysql> SELECT * FROM table_name;

这里的SELECT * FROM table_name是一个简单的查询语句,将会返回table_name表中的所有数据。

4. 关闭mysql连接

在完成mysql操作后,为了释放资源和断开连接,我们需要关闭mysql连接。这可以通过在mysql命令行中输入exit命令来实现。

以下是关闭mysql连接的代码示例:

mysql> exit

执行该命令后,将会退出mysql命令行,并回到操作系统的命令行界面。

示例序列图

sequenceDiagram
    participant 小白
    participant 开发者

    小白->>开发者: 问如何在命令行执行mysql语句?
    开发者->>小白: 首先,你需要准备mysql命令行环境
    开发者->>小白: 其次,连接到mysql数据库
    开发者->>小白: 然后,执行mysql语句
    开发者->>小白: 最后,关闭mysql连接
    开发者->>小白: 我会给你提供示例代码和说明

    Note right of 开发者: 小白按照流程执行

    小白->>开发者: 执行完毕,谢谢!
    开发者->>小白: 不客气,如果有其他问题可以随时问我!

代码示例解释

连接到mysql数据库

mysql -h localhost -P 3306 -u username -p

这段代码中的参数解释如下:

  • -h localhost:连接到本地数据库;
  • -P 3306:使用默认的mysql端口号;
  • -u username:使用username作为连接的用户名;
  • -p:表示需要输入密码。

执行mysql语句

mysql> SELECT * FROM table_name;

这段代码表示执行一个简单的查询语句,将会返回table_name表中的所有数据。你可以根据实际需求,替换为其他的mysql语句。

关闭mysql连接

mysql> exit

这段代码表示退出mysql命令行,并返回到操作系统的命令行界面。

总结

通过以上的流程和代码示例,你应该能够学会如何在命令行执行mysql语句了。记住,首先需要准备mysql命令行环境,然后连接到mysql数据库,执行mysql语句,最后关闭mysql连接。如果有任何问题,请随时向我提问!